VESC Monitor Android App

I have been using your app easily for over a year now. But now it seems that the app doesn’t show my boards anymore. I have two boards and none are shown on my phone. I have android 8 and the hm-10 clone you suggested.

Did you update your smartphone to Android 8 since then? Because the HM-10 clones don’t work with Android 8. You need to update the firmware on the modules to work with it.

That is the case. Is there a new module I could buy, which supports Android 8, because I don’t have an arduino?

FYI, tested the app with a Unity, all seems to work. The only thing I noticed is that the motor current value is for only one motor, but I think that is how it is expected to work.

I would love to see motor temperature displayed and logged. Thanks for all your work on this.

2 Likes

Just released a new update which for the unity support which summarizes the data of both motors and shows it. So in case you are using a unity you should set 1 motor in the settings to see the correct data.

4 Likes

It works great. Im getting motor currents that make sense now.

@Ackmaniac dude, just took my board for my first ride and was pleasantly surprised that the app keeps record of all the data. You made a seriously great app. You are a gentleman and a scholar.

PS on another note, does anyone know how to (If possible) autosave the distance/location/time aspect of the ride? So each time I go for a ride it saves a map view of where I went? I know there are some apps for runners and stuff, but i wouldn’t be surprised if this app had it too.

1 Like

It saves those logs in a folder on your phone automatically and you can use something like VDLA to view the logs in a nice map with stats.

2 Likes

great App Bro!! I just would to see an Evo shape … is there a way to change that?

Hi guys, I recently had some issues with the Ackmaniac android app not showing data / shows data periodically. So basically I was using adc+uart on my e-bike. I decided to use an arduino to convert the adc input to ppm input so I could change modes on the android app. This was prior to the 3.103 update which allowed mode change on adc. I accidentally swapped tx rx for 5v and gnd. Then when I swapped it back to the correct position, the android app stopped showing data. All I did was change to ppm+uart from adc+uart. Everything else was the same. The vesc worked fine, no issues with performance at all. The bluetooth data just didnt show. I changed a bluetooth module and got it to work for 5 minutes. Then it just stopped working again. I took it out for a ride and it worked, I could change modes and everything. Then it just stopped again. I thought that I could have damaged my vesc by my mistake of swapping tx rx with 5v and gnd. So I tried to solder jumper wires to pin 28/29 on the microcontroller on the vesc itself after reading about someone having same issues as me (intermittent connections) and having success connecting 28/29 directly to the bluetooth modules, bypassing the traces on the pcb of the vesc. I ended up fucking that up and that was the end of my vesc.

So I bought another one, and the same issue happened. I doubt it’s software since it’s intermittent, it’s not weak signal, I put my phone right next to the module and it still didn’t work. I doubt its hardware since I changed to a whole new vesc.

Whenever I unplug the vesc, the data suddenly shows up on the android app. Like for a split second it sends data before I unplug it completely. This is what shows up during the unplugging process. Screenshot_20190201-214201 I honestly don’t know what could be the problem, I reinstalled everything, factory resetting my phone as well, trying with another phone, same issue. If anyone could provide some insight into this I would be very thankful.

hello yours akmaniac app can this connect to a focbox unity? thank you

As far as i know only via additional HM-10 BLE module. I don’t have a UNITY myself but that’s what i heard.

2 Likes

I just tested and it not works I do not have the information but jarrive me to connect I must have the app akmaniac in the focbox unity or I can uses the one of enertion? Thank you for the quick reply

Hi, I am having problems with the android app. I have the new expensive BT module that works with all the apps. I am using ackmaniac firmware and I am able to connect via the ackmaniac esc tool but no data is displayed and when I click on add modes it will say “esc not connected” It is working all with the METR and PERIMETR app. no problem. Any suggestions?

Did you set the baud rate to 9600? If not then this is the reason.

Yeah I had it set to 115200 or something like that, other apps worked but to make sure I have set it to 9600 today and still the same.

You definitely need the value of 9600, other apps use different baud rates. When it doesn’t work with 9600 then you could try it with an older phone/android version as some people have troubles with the latest android fw and HM-10 clones.

1 Like

That’s why I bought the one that should have full support and should work with everything. Definitelly with ackmaniac. https://eskating.eu/product/bluetooth-uart-metr-pro-module-for-electric-skateboards-all-apps-os/ I miss the video recording overlay function, ackmaniac has it the best.

The baud rate is only for the communication from the vesc to the module. The app doesn’t care about the baudrate.

2 Likes

Ah interesting. So you advice to set it to 9600 because of the HM-10 BT module and it can be different for other modules if I understand it right.